Resolver la inecuacion 3x -14 <7x -2

Mathematics
1 answer:
aniked [119]4 years ago
8 0
The answer to this question is: x>-3
3x-14<7x-2
3x<7x+12
-4x<12
4x>-12
x>-3

What is the value of b?
STatiana [176]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

By the polygon exterior angle sum theorem, all the exterior angles of a polygon add up to equal 360 regardless of the number of sides it has. That means that 82 + 150 + b = 360 so

b + 232 = 360 and

b = 128
